No Man’s Sky players invented a coin and hope to never trade it for real money

No Man’s Sky player community has responded to the shortcomings of the game by inventing and implementing its own in-game cryptocurrency. Hub coin Run on the Ethereum testnet Goerli, it has no real value and cannot be redeemed for real money. However, the community doesn’t care. In fact, they want it to remain worthless.

A member of Hubcoin Treasury, ItalicInterloper, Said:

“Hubcoin has no in-game analog. Its growth depends entirely on players who trust each other on social media and chat and make round trips to goods and services for the right amount of money.

This is a very different relationship from the developers who implement and adjust the player’s economics through the game code. When new players sign up for Hubcoin, we all celebrate with them. Answer a variety of questions about your sign-up account and GHUB’s revenue and spending potential. “

Player community No man’s sky Yourself Galaxy hub It is one of the largest communities in the game.It was created by an unknown player named 7101334 It has grown since 2016 in 2016.The hub acts as the actual civilization inside No man’s sky There is a map and its holidays, symbols, and architectural signposts.

Hubcoin was introduced as the currency of this civilization. However, holding hub coins is optional. Currently, there are 291 citizens registered in the Galactic Hub, but only 149 own Hub Coins.

Not worth it is good

Citizens of the Galactic Hub responded to the introduction of Hubcoin for two reasons. It’s the environmental cost of coining coins and you don’t want to turn the game into a job. Both concerns were shared by both the developer members and the president of the Galactic Hub.

The community addressed environmental issues using Ethereum’s Goerli testnet, which uses the Proof-of-Authority.

Comment on the changes that real currencies bring to the game ItalicInterloper Said:

“When players can’cash out’to the dollar, crypto wallets are the main goal, and video games are the way to do that. The in-game economy is trivial for endgame players, and it can take time for developers to protect themselves from exploits. “

The community agreed that once real interests were photographed, everyone would look for their best interests and the Galactic Hub civilization would lose its credibility. Therefore, they all agreed to keep Hubcoin on the testnet and prohibit it from being exchanged for any other currency of value.

Why do you have coins when they are not worth it?

It seems pointless to implement worthless coins in the game. However, Hubcoin remains very relative due to its utility-based features.

Players who have reached No man’s sky Endgames usually have a large number of game coins. Players don’t know where to spend their cash because they can duplicate anything at that point in the game.

At the same time, the game allows endgame players to do Build a base When Customize That’s the way they want. Hubcoin plays a key role at the time, between players who don’t have the time, level, or resources to build a customized base, and endgame players who can be as creative as they need in the architecture. Make a bridge. Players can use hub coins to purchase customized buildings from endgame players, while endgame players can purchase items that can only be achieved by player activity from other players.

7101334 Summarizing the in-game economics, he states:

“”[players] They want to pay for an artistic canvas on the base, have a PC player save and edit a custom fauna companion, have a seasoned architect help with the design and interior decoration of the base, or just The convenience of not collecting your resources for something simple. “

Whatever the exchange, the community agrees that HubCoin doesn’t need real value.
